IDEAS home Printed from https://ideas.repec.org/p/msh/ebswps/2019-20.html
   My bibliography  Save this paper

Anomaly Detection in High Dimensional Data

Author

Listed:
  • Priyanga Dilini Talagala
  • Rob J Hyndman
  • Kate Smith-Miles

Abstract

The HDoutliers algorithm is a powerful unsupervised algorithm for detecting anomalies in high-dimensional data, with a strong theoretical foundation. However, it suffers from some limitations that significantly hinder its performance level, under certain circumstances. In this article, we propose an algorithm that addresses these limitations. We define an anomaly as an observation that deviates markedly from the majority with a large distance gap. An approach based on extreme value theory is used for the anomalous threshold calculation. Using various synthetic and real datasets, we demonstrate the wide applicability and usefulness of our algorithm, which we call the stray algorithm. We also demonstrate how this algorithm can assist in detecting anomalies present in other data structures using feature engineering. We show the situations where the stray algorithm outperforms the HDoutliers algorithm both in accuracy and computational time. This framework is implemented in the open source R package stray.

Suggested Citation

  • Priyanga Dilini Talagala & Rob J Hyndman & Kate Smith-Miles, 2019. "Anomaly Detection in High Dimensional Data," Monash Econometrics and Business Statistics Working Papers 20/19, Monash University, Department of Econometrics and Business Statistics.
  • Handle: RePEc:msh:ebswps:2019-20
    as

    Download full text from publisher

    File URL: https://www.monash.edu/business/ebs/research/publications/ebs/wp20-2019.pdf
    Download Restriction: no
    ---><---

    References listed on IDEAS

    as
    1. Kang, Yanfei & Hyndman, Rob J. & Smith-Miles, Kate, 2017. "Visualising forecasting algorithm performance using time series instance spaces," International Journal of Forecasting, Elsevier, vol. 33(2), pages 345-358.
    2. Peter Burridge & A. M. Robert Taylor, 2006. "Additive Outlier Detection Via Extreme‐Value Theory," Journal of Time Series Analysis, Wiley Blackwell, vol. 27(5), pages 685-701, September.
    3. Markus Goldstein & Seiichi Uchida, 2016. "A Comparative Evaluation of Unsupervised Anomaly Detection Algorithms for Multivariate Data," PLOS ONE, Public Library of Science, vol. 11(4), pages 1-31, April.
    Full references (including those not matched with items on IDEAS)

    Most related items

    These are the items that most often cite the same works as this one and are cited by the same works as this one.
    1. Sevvandi Kandanaarachchi & Mario A Munoz & Rob J Hyndman & Kate Smith-Miles, 2018. "On normalization and algorithm selection for unsupervised outlier detection," Monash Econometrics and Business Statistics Working Papers 16/18, Monash University, Department of Econometrics and Business Statistics.
    2. Priyanga Dilini Talagala & Rob J Hyndman & Catherine Leigh & Kerrie Mengersen & Kate Smith-Miles, 2019. "A Feature-Based Framework for Detecting Technical Outliers in Water-Quality Data from In Situ Sensors," Monash Econometrics and Business Statistics Working Papers 1/19, Monash University, Department of Econometrics and Business Statistics.
    3. Priyanga Dilini Talagala & Rob J Hyndman & Kate Smith-Miles & Sevvandi Kandanaarachchi & Mario A Munoz, 2018. "Anomaly detection in streaming nonstationary temporal data," Monash Econometrics and Business Statistics Working Papers 4/18, Monash University, Department of Econometrics and Business Statistics.
    4. Petropoulos, Fotios & Apiletti, Daniele & Assimakopoulos, Vassilios & Babai, Mohamed Zied & Barrow, Devon K. & Ben Taieb, Souhaib & Bergmeir, Christoph & Bessa, Ricardo J. & Bijak, Jakub & Boylan, Joh, 2022. "Forecasting: theory and practice," International Journal of Forecasting, Elsevier, vol. 38(3), pages 705-871.
      • Fotios Petropoulos & Daniele Apiletti & Vassilios Assimakopoulos & Mohamed Zied Babai & Devon K. Barrow & Souhaib Ben Taieb & Christoph Bergmeir & Ricardo J. Bessa & Jakub Bijak & John E. Boylan & Jet, 2020. "Forecasting: theory and practice," Papers 2012.03854, arXiv.org, revised Jan 2022.
    5. Smyl, Slawek, 2020. "A hybrid method of exponential smoothing and recurrent neural networks for time series forecasting," International Journal of Forecasting, Elsevier, vol. 36(1), pages 75-85.
    6. Yin, Sihua & Yang, Haidong & Xu, Kangkang & Zhu, Chengjiu & Zhang, Shaqing & Liu, Guosheng, 2022. "Dynamic real–time abnormal energy consumption detection and energy efficiency optimization analysis considering uncertainty," Applied Energy, Elsevier, vol. 307(C).
    7. Thiyanga S. Talagala & Feng Li & Yanfei Kang, 2019. "Feature-based Forecast-Model Performance Prediction," Monash Econometrics and Business Statistics Working Papers 21/19, Monash University, Department of Econometrics and Business Statistics.
    8. Bojer, Casper Solheim & Meldgaard, Jens Peder, 2021. "Kaggle forecasting competitions: An overlooked learning opportunity," International Journal of Forecasting, Elsevier, vol. 37(2), pages 587-603.
    9. Huber, Jakob & Stuckenschmidt, Heiner, 2020. "Daily retail demand forecasting using machine learning with emphasis on calendric special days," International Journal of Forecasting, Elsevier, vol. 36(4), pages 1420-1438.
    10. Gabriel Rodriguez & Dionisio Ramirez, 2014. "A Note on the Size of the ADF Test with Additive Outliers and Fractional Errors. A Reappraisal about the (Non)Stationarity of the Latin-American Inflation Series," Revista Economía, Fondo Editorial - Pontificia Universidad Católica del Perú, vol. 37(73), pages 113-132.
    11. Li, Li & Kang, Yanfei & Li, Feng, 2023. "Bayesian forecast combination using time-varying features," International Journal of Forecasting, Elsevier, vol. 39(3), pages 1287-1302.
    12. Olivier Darné & Amélie Charles, 2012. "A note on the uncertain trend in US real GNP: Evidence from robust unit root tests," Economics Bulletin, AccessEcon, vol. 32(3), pages 2399-2406.
    13. Thiyanga S Talagala & Rob J Hyndman & George Athanasopoulos, 2018. "Meta-learning how to forecast time series," Monash Econometrics and Business Statistics Working Papers 6/18, Monash University, Department of Econometrics and Business Statistics.
    14. Harvey, David I. & Leybourne, Stephen J. & Taylor, A.M. Robert, 2010. "Robust methods for detecting multiple level breaks in autocorrelated time series," Journal of Econometrics, Elsevier, vol. 157(2), pages 342-358, August.
    15. Yang, Dazhi & van der Meer, Dennis, 2021. "Post-processing in solar forecasting: Ten overarching thinking tools," Renewable and Sustainable Energy Reviews, Elsevier, vol. 140(C).
    16. Piero Mazzarisi & Adele Ravagnani & Paola Deriu & Fabrizio Lillo & Francesca Medda & Antonio Russo, 2022. "A machine learning approach to support decision in insider trading detection," Papers 2212.05912, arXiv.org.
    17. Wang, Xiaoqian & Hyndman, Rob J. & Li, Feng & Kang, Yanfei, 2023. "Forecast combinations: An over 50-year review," International Journal of Forecasting, Elsevier, vol. 39(4), pages 1518-1547.
    18. Cian Ryan & Finbarr Murphy & Martin Mullins, 2019. "Semiautonomous Vehicle Risk Analysis: A Telematics‐Based Anomaly Detection Approach," Risk Analysis, John Wiley & Sons, vol. 39(5), pages 1125-1140, May.
    19. Elmira Asadi-Fard & Samereh Falahatkar & Mahdi Tanha Ziyarati & Xiaodong Zhang & Mariapia Faruolo, 2023. "Assessment of RXD Algorithm Capability for Gas Flaring Detection through OLI-SWIR Channels," Sustainability, MDPI, vol. 15(6), pages 1-20, March.
    20. Chen, Yi-Hsuan & Tu, Anthony H., 2013. "Estimating hedged portfolio value-at-risk using the conditional copula: An illustration of model risk," International Review of Economics & Finance, Elsevier, vol. 27(C), pages 514-528.

    More about this item

    Keywords

    data stream; high-dimensional data; nearest neighbour searching; unsupervised outlier detection;
    All these keywords.

    JEL classification:

    • C1 - Mathematical and Quantitative Methods - - Econometric and Statistical Methods and Methodology: General
    • C8 - Mathematical and Quantitative Methods - - Data Collection and Data Estimation Methodology; Computer Programs
    • C55 - Mathematical and Quantitative Methods - - Econometric Modeling - - - Large Data Sets: Modeling and Analysis

    NEP fields

    This paper has been announced in the following NEP Reports:

    Statistics

    Access and download statistics

    Corrections

    All material on this site has been provided by the respective publishers and authors. You can help correct errors and omissions. When requesting a correction, please mention this item's handle: RePEc:msh:ebswps:2019-20. See general information about how to correct material in RePEc.

    If you have authored this item and are not yet registered with RePEc, we encourage you to do it here. This allows to link your profile to this item. It also allows you to accept potential citations to this item that we are uncertain about.

    If CitEc recognized a bibliographic reference but did not link an item in RePEc to it, you can help with this form .

    If you know of missing items citing this one, you can help us creating those links by adding the relevant references in the same way as above, for each refering item. If you are a registered author of this item, you may also want to check the "citations" tab in your RePEc Author Service profile, as there may be some citations waiting for confirmation.

    For technical questions regarding this item, or to correct its authors, title, abstract, bibliographic or download information, contact: Professor Xibin Zhang (email available below). General contact details of provider: https://edirc.repec.org/data/dxmonau.html .

    Please note that corrections may take a couple of weeks to filter through the various RePEc services.

    IDEAS is a RePEc service. RePEc uses bibliographic data supplied by the respective publishers.